They say one person’s trash is another person’s treasure. A Canadian designer is turning trash into fashion in a durable and chic way. Padina Bondar is weaving her magic using literal garbage to create garments that are absolutely glamorous. Her clothing items are on display at a new exhibition in Toronto. As Mike Drolet explains, it’s amazing what you can do with plastic waste.
